What they do

A Logging Worker or Supervisor harvests forest trees to provide lumber for building or consumer products. Cuts down and trim trees, cuts logs, and inspects and drags lumber to loading areas for shipment by truck.

Log Yard Technician:
Hawkeye Forest Products LP., a subsidiary of Baillie Lumber Co., has an immediate opening for an Log Yard Technician in Trempealeau Wisconsin. Located in the village of Trempealeau, Wisconsin, Hawkeye Forest Products specializes in the production of green and kiln dried Walnut lumber. We utilize a modern sawmill and drying facility, producing high quality lumber, timbers and other proprietary and custom products.
General Job Description:
The primary function of this position is to assist with the incoming and outgoing flow of hardwood logs at our log yard. Duties will include log sorting, scaling, and decking of log utilizing front-end loader and knuckle boom.
Specific Requirements:
(including but not limited to) Receiving and scaling incoming logs for species, grades and sorts per company guidelines. Operate handheld data collectors to input species, grades and sorts. Chainsaw operation as needed. Adherence to facility safety policies.
Essential Experience:
Experience operating front-end loader and/or knuckle boom preferred A degree from a two year technical program or 4 year undergraduate program in a forest products related filed will be considered as a substitute for field experience. Would be willing to train the right candidate.
